Yulong Base Profile

Yulong Base is a 6 year old brown or black gelding. Yulong Base is trained by Cody Morgan, at Tamworth and owned by Australian Bloodstock (Mgr: L Murrell), D Healey, M Thomas, P Porter, R Clarke, D & K O'Brien Racing (Mgr: D O'Brien), M Johnson, K Hartigan, M Parnis, M Carter, D Green, D Purkiss, Not First You're Last (Mgr: W Harvey), J Bower, T Fleming, I Cochrane, W Chilton & J Lovett.

Yulong Base’s last race event was at 25/09/2021 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Yulong Base Racing Form

Career form is 2 wins, 3 seconds, 3 thirds from 12 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$79,060.

With a 17% Win Percentage and 67% Place Percentage. Yulong Base's last race event was at Rosehill.

Exposed form for its last starts is 0-0-6-3-0.
